- Building code
- 2024 IBC/IRC/IMC/IFGC with amendments (effective January 1, 2026). As an incorporated ND city electing to enforce building codes, Newburg must adopt the ND State Building Code. Confirm enforcement posture with city.
- Contractor requirements
- ND Secretary of State contractor license required for hired work over $4,000. State licenses required for electrical and plumbing work.
